Overview
The overall goal of this VISTA assignment is to build the capacity of the Southeast Utah Health Department (SEUHD) to secure sustainable funding that expands environmental health and prevention programs serving underserved and low‑income populations in Grand, Carbon, and Emery Counties. By strengthening grant development and resource acquisition systems, the VISTA will help address poverty‑related health disparities linked to unsafe housing, environmental hazards, mental health challenges, and substance use.
The VISTA will increase SEUHD’s capacity to secure external funding by developing tools, systems, and relationships that support ongoing grant identification, writing, tracking, and reporting.
- Develop grant narratives, budgets, and supporting documentation.
- Create a centralized grant calendar and tracking system.
- Research funding opportunities, including those for environmental health services related to housing issues such as mold, pest infestations, and failing septic systems.
- Assist with data collection and outcome reporting.
- Support grant writing for prevention programs such as health promotion, harm reduction services, and the Parents as Teachers program.
- Compile community needs data, document service gaps, and develop impact statements.
- Document outcomes and success stories, develop templates to streamline submissions, and support cross‑program collaboration.
